What are some popular pine barrens ghost stories?

2 answers
2024-11-27 11:51

One well - known pine barrens ghost story is about the Jersey Devil. Legend has it that this creature, often described as a flying biped with hooves and a horse - like head, haunts the pine barrens. It's said to have been born to a woman named Mother Leeds in the 18th century. Another story involves the ghosts of settlers who perished in the harsh conditions of the pine barrens long ago, and their apparitions are sometimes seen wandering through the desolate areas at night.
